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,774,769
Lastest Block:
1,964,082
Utxos:
1,983,827
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
30/04/2021 19:09:04 UTC
Txid
78ceb4cd38eee857dea3d108a0316ce13263ba98d27bcc94895b9d62785efbde
Block
135,199
Block hash
5d5312ed836eb284ba7c73bd63217240a96b964dc0f70aceb7226ea0f9aad0dd
Stake amount
441.76045631 XEP
Sender
ep1qf2rhu2lj9szv44esav5cl33t2dswrfzahqcxmr
Recipient
ep1qf2rhu2lj9szv44esav5cl33t2dswrfzahqcxmr
(399,082.07680856 XEP)